Pascal. Составные условия в команде сравнения IF

 

Составные условия

Составные условия в команде сравнения IF

В этом уроке рассматривются логические операции И, ИЛИ, НЕ; их использование в команде сравнения IF. В состав урока входят презентация, план урока, тестовые задания и условия задач по данной теме.

Скачать (1650  Кб)

План уроков № 11 и 12

Урок № 11
Тема:
Составные условия в команде сравнения IF
Логические выражения

Триединая задача урока:

1. Познавательная – познакомить учеников с использованием логических выражений в команде IF, привести примеры.
2. Развивающая – развивать логическое мышление.
3. Воспитательная – воспитывать творческий подход к труду.

      1. Мотивация учебной деятельности учеников

    Достаточно часто при составлении программ не достаточно простых условий . Для создания более сложных условий и используются составные или сложные условия.

      1. Объявление темы и ожидаемых результатов

    После этого урока ученики смогут:

    1. • Рассказать о сложных условиях в команде сравнения IF;
    1. • Объяснить назначение логических операндов И, ИЛИ, НЕ;
      1. • Объяснить правила построения логических выражений и приоритет операций в них;

      2. Объяснение нового материала – презентация. Во время объяснения сопровождать показ слайдов демонстрацией работы в среде программирования Turbo Pascal;

    • Назначение логических операций;

    1. • Результат работы И, ИЛИ, НЕ;
    1. • Приоритет операций;
    1. • Примеры программ.
  1. Физкультминутка.
  2. Обсуждение пройденного материала
  3. Итоги урока.
  4. Домашнее задание: выучить § 16 стр. 119, № 5 а, б; 6 а, б. (Глинський Я.М. Інформатика Алгоритмізація і програмування. Частина І. 4 видання 2004 р. Львів)

Урок № 12
Практическая работа:
«Составление программ с использованием составных условий
в команде сравнения IF»

Триединая задача урока:

1. Познавательная – учить детей использовать составные условия при составлении программ.
2. Развивающая – развивать логическое мышление.
3. Воспитательная – воспитывать творческий подход к труду.

      1. Мотивация учебной деятельности учеников

    Учитель предлагает ученикам составить и запустить на компьютере программы с использованием составных условий в команде IF и проверить, как компьютер проверяет условия и выполняет различные действия.

      1. . Объявление темы и ожидаемых результатов

    После этого урока ученики смогут:

    1. • Использовать составные условия в команде сравнения IF при составлении программ;
      1. • Объяснить почему компьютер выполняет разные действия в зависимости от проверяемых условий;

      2. Выполнение практической работы
      3. Физкультминутка.
      4. Обсуждение хода практической работы.
      5. Итоги урока.
      6. Домашнее задание:

    • Повторить: § 16 (Глинський Я.М. Інформатика Алгоритмізація і програмування. Частина І. 4 видання 2004 р. Львів)

    1. • Составить программы:

      1. Написать программу, которая спрашивает «Который час?» и, в зависимости от введенного времени, выводит на экран приветствие:

«Доброе утро», «Добрый день», «Добрый вечер», «Спокойной ночи».

      1. Написать программу, которая определяет, принадлежит ли точка с координатами (X, Y) заштрихованной области, ограниченной точками

(X1, Y1) (X2, Y2) Входные данные: координаты точек (X, Y) , (X1, Y1), (X2, Y2) Результат: слова «Да» или «Нет».

Список уроков по Паскалю
Авторские уроки Марины Макаровой

К уроку информатики